Overview

Saudi Aramco is seeking for an experienced Electrical Technician (Fabrication, Welding & NDT) to work in Mechanical Services Shops Department (MSSD) in Abqaiq / Planning and Technical Services Division having hands on experience Provides work direction, technical guidance, and supervision for work crews in the fabrication, welding, and repair of plant pressure vessels, piping, and auxiliary equipment. And act a mentor if required.

MSSD has state-of-the-art workshops and facilities that are driven by our most valuable asset, which is the department's skilled and experienced workforce. Its primary responsibility is to maintain Saudi Aramco's rotating and stationary equipment. The department plays a vital role in the company as it provides support to all field organizations by maintaining and repairing corporate equipment.

Duties and Responsibilities

Provides work direction for a crew of 6-10 craftsmen. Evaluates work in progress to control product quality and work team productivity. Reviews outstanding work requests to plan manpower assignments and to determine specific requirements for materials, tools, and department.

Requests materials, tools, and equipment for fabrication work through the SAMS system or through the Maintenance Planner. Performs administrative duties as required of Group Head, including report writing and record keeping regarding welding work performed by crews under his supervision.

Provides technical advice and guidance to lower craftsmen, operations and maintenance to assist in planning T&Is or large fabrication projects. Ensures that all craftsmen working under his direction follow safe and proper welding procedures, in adherence to all pertinent company standards.

Performs on-the-job training and mentoring for lower qualified craftsmen under his direction, and maintains records of on-job training accomplishments of all craftsmen in the unit.

Troubleshoots and performs the necessary analysis on complex projects to determine (a) if repair is required, (b) nature of repair to be made, and (c) whether repairs will be made in shop or field.

Minimum Requirements

Associate Degree in Electrical Engineering with a minimum of 10 years' in fabrication, welding & NDT field as stipulated above under position description. Candidate must have the following the field experience requirements.

 

  • Experience in Serving as the technical authority concerning all fabrication, vessel maintenance, equipment installation and repair, and/or testing, inspection, and welding.
  • responsible for directing and controlling the work of 6-10 Welders, Pipefitter/Fabricators, and Field Metals Mechanics in projects involving fabrication of pipe spools and structural steel assemblies or repair of plant piping and equipment
